Transaction ce6011480314d82a7035afe4dc45d11981110eb40c3dde4995c0c377e9d79a56
1 Input
1 Output
-
ce6011480314d82a7035afe4dc45d11981110eb40c3dde4995c0c377e9d79a56:0
- value
- 74837000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 abc9345cc4c145622a0569e763e4c0662781cc5d OP_EQUAL
- address
- 3HMLWHPLA9m29uwVNRQ4G9TjyYZF4iyoRj